Gov. Rendell to Name Chair of Working Group for Stimulus Accountability, Chief Accountability Officer for Federal Stimulus Funding Governor Edward G. Rendell will hold a news conference at 12:30 p.m. on Tuesday, March 31, in his Reception Room, 225 Main Capitol Building, Harrisburg, to announce the Chairman of Governor's Working Group for Stimulus Accountability and Chief Accountability Officer who will oversee investments from the American Recovery and Reinvestment Act. The first meeting of the Pennsylvania Stimulus Oversight Committee, which Governor Rendell created by executive order on March 27, will be held in the Reception Room following the news conference.
